I noticed on my right rear brake caliper that the metal slider ( sorry i dont know the correct terminology) at the top of the caliper is sliding out towards the rim. I knocked it back in however it keeps on sliding out and is very close to fouling with the inside of the rim Any advice would be appreciated thanks. |

Caliper slide. You might be able to make a small bend in the inside edge of it to keep it in. But I'm not sure how they are attached originally. |

You need to replace it. They are brittle and the tabs that hold them in place break off easily. You can buy a whole set from Autozone for about $8. Buy the brake disk hardware kit - front or rear |

Thanks guys. I noticed that the one side on the slide was broken so i nipped the end with a pliers to stop it from coming off and bent the tab to give it more tension. Temporary job until I can buy the kit. |
